﻿
.head_td
{
	height: 30px;
	width: 100%;
	background-color: #003366;
}
.top_menu
{
	margin: 5px 10px 10px 10px;
	font-family: Arial;
	font-size: 12px;
	font-weight: bold;
	text-decoration: none;
	color: #FFFFFF;
}
.heading1
{
	font-family: Cambria;
	font-size: 16px;
	font-weight: bold;
	color: #003366;
}
.form_td1
{
	font-family: Arial;
	font-size: 12px;
	font-weight: bold;
	color: #333333;
	padding-left: 10px;
	text-align: left;
	vertical-align: top;
}
.form_td2
{
	font-family: Arial;
	font-size: 11px;
	color: #333333;
	text-align: left;
	vertical-align: top;
}
.msg
{
	font-family: Arial;
	font-size: 13px;
	font-weight: bold;
	color: #990000;
}
.lnk
{
	font-family: Arial;
	font-size: 12px;
	font-weight: bold;
	color: #003366;
	text-decoration: none;
}
.lnk_larg
{
	font-family: Arial;
	font-size: 18px;
	font-weight: bold;
	color: #003366;
	text-decoration: none;
}
/*
.grid-view
{
	padding: 0;
	margin: 0;
	border: 1px solid #333;
	font-family: Arial;
	font-size: 12px;
	width: 100%;
}

.grid-view tr.header
{
	color: white;
	background-color: #666699;
	height: 25px;
	vertical-align: middle;
	text-align: center;
	font-weight: bold;
	font-family: Arial;
	font-size: 14px;
}

.grid-view tr.normal
{
	color: black;
	height: 25px;
	vertical-align: middle;
	text-align: left;
}

.grid-view tr.alternate
{
	color: black;
	height: 25px;
	vertical-align: middle;
	text-align: left;
}

.grid-view tr.normal:hover, .grid-view tr.alternate:hover
{
	background-color: white;
	color: black;
	font-family: Arial;
	background-color: #99CCFF;
}
*/

.mGrid { width: 100%; background-color: #fff; margin: 5px 0 10px 0; border: solid 1px #525252; border-collapse:collapse; }
    .mGrid td
{
	padding: 2px;
	border: solid 1px #c1c1c1;
	color: #333333;
	font-size: 11px;
}
    .mGrid td1
{
	border-style: solid;
	border-width: 0px;
	border-color: #c1c1c1;
	padding: 2px;
	color: #333333;
}
    .mGrid .link
{
	padding: 2px;
	border: solid 1px #c1c1c1;
	color: #003399;
	text-decoration: none;
}
.mGrid tr.normal:hover, .mGrid tr.alternate:hover
{
	background-color: white;
	color: black;
	background-color: #99CCFF;
}
    .mGrid th
{
	padding: 4px 2px;
	color: #fff;
	background: #424242;
	border-left: solid 1px #525252;
	font-size: 10px;
}
.mGrid .alt { background: #fcfcfc url(grd_alt.png) repeat-x top; }
.mGrid .pgr {background: #424242 url(grd_pgr.png) repeat-x top; }
    .mGrid .pgr table { margin: 5px 0; }
    .mGrid .pgr td { border-width: 0; padding: 0 6px; border-left: solid 1px #666; font-weight: bold; color: #fff; line-height: 12px; }   
    .mGrid .pgr a { color: #666; text-decoration: none; }
    .mGrid .pgr a:hover
{
	color: #000;
}
.report_td1
{
	color: #003366;
	font-weight: bold;
	font-size: 11px;
	font-family: Arial, Helvetica, sans-serif;
}

/***********  New grid style by amit start   ********************/
.amitGrid
{
	width: 100%;
	background-color: #fff;
	margin: 5px 0 10px 0;
	border: solid 1px #525252;

}
    .amitGrid td
{
	padding: 2px;
	border: solid 1px #333333;
	color: #003366;
	font-size: 10px;
}
    .amitGrid .link
{
	padding: 2px;
	color: #003366;
	text-decoration: none;
	font-weight: bold;
}
.amitGrid tr.normal:hover, .amitGrid tr.alternate:hover
{
	background-color: white;
	color: #333333;
	background-color: #66CCFF;
}
.amitGrid th
{
	padding: 4px 2px;
	color: #fff;
	background: #006699;
	border-left: solid 1px #525252;
	font-size: 10px;
	text-align: center;
}
.amitGrid .alt { background: #fcfcfc url(grd_alt.png) repeat-x top; }
.amitGrid .pgr
{
	background: #006699 repeat-x top;
}
 .amitGrid .pgr table
{
	margin: 2px 0 2px 0;
}
.amitGrid .pgr td
{
	border-width: 0;
	padding: 0 6px;
	border-left: solid 1px #666;
	font-weight: bold;
	color: #00FFFF;
	line-height: 12px;
	border-left-color: #CCCCFF;
}   
    .amitGrid .pgr a
{
	color: #CCCCFF;
	text-decoration: none;
}
    .amitGrid .pgr a:hover
{
	color: #000;
}
/***********  New grid style by amit end   ********************/
.ddl
{
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#333333;
}

/*
.rptr_table
{
	border: 1px solid #CCCCCC;
	width: 100%;
	background-color: #FFFFFF;
}
.rptr_table_header
{
	background-color: #006699;
	font-weight: bold;
	color: #FFFFFF;
}
.rptr_table_header
{
	padding: 3px;
	border-width: 1px;
	border-color: #CCCCCC;
	width: 100%;
	background-color: #006699;
	color: #FFFFFF;
	font-weight: bold;
}
*/
/***** Autocmplete start ******/
.autocomplete_completionListElement
{
	padding: 1px;
	visibility: hidden;
	margin: 0px !important;
	background-color: #F2FFF2;
	color: windowtext;
	border: buttonshadow;
	border-width: 1px;
	border-style: solid;
	cursor: 'default';
	overflow: auto;
	height:auto;
	text-align: left;
	list-style-type: none;
	font-family: verdana;
	table-layout: auto;
	border-collapse: collapse;
	border-spacing: 1px;
	empty-cells: hide;
	caption-side: top;
}

/* AutoComplete highlighted item */

.autocomplete_highlightedListItem
{
	border: thin solid #CCCCCC;
	background-color: #F2FFF2;
	color: #3366FF;
}

/* AutoComplete item */

.autocomplete_listItem
{
	background-color: #ECFFFF;
	color: windowtext;
	padding: 1px;
}
/******* AutoComplete end **********/

.form td 
{
	background: #D7E6F4;
	color: #333333;
	font: small "Segoe UI", Segoe, sans-serif;
	padding: 15px 10px 10px 10px;	
}


/************************ data control  **********/


.rptr
{
	width: 100%;
	background-color: #fff;
	margin: 0px 0 0px 0;
	border: solid 0.5px #525252;
	border-collapse: collapse;
}
   .rptr td
{
	padding: 2px;
	border: solid 1px #c1c1c1;
	color: #003366;
	font-size: 11px;
}
     .rptr th
{
	color: #FFFFFF;
	font-size: 13px;
	background-color: #006699;
	font-weight: bold;
	font-family: Cambria;
} 
    .rptr .link
{
	padding: 2px;
	border: solid 1px #c1c1c1;
	color: #003399;
	text-decoration: none;
}
.rptr tr.normal:hover, .rptr tr.alternate:hover
{
	background-color: white;
	color: black;
	background-color: #99CCFF;
}

